Nuclear Weapons: Finance

Asked by Mike MartinLiberal DemocratMinistry of DefenceTabled Answered 19 November 2024UIN 14405

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Defence, if it is government policy to cover overspends from the Defence Nuclear Enterprise budget from the wider Defence budget or from the Treasury reserve.

Answered by Maria Eagle

If an overspend within the Defence Nuclear Enterprise could not be managed within the ringfenced budget, then options to manage this within the wider Defence budget would be considered.

This is distinct from the Dreadnought programme for which HM Treasury hold a separate £10 billion contingency.
